![]() ![]() ![]() These are the rights of the committee derived from the writings of John Locke. They wrote, “it becomes necessary for one people to dissolve the political bands which have connected them to another.” Following this, the committee affirms that we possess certain rights. The committee starts the introduction of the document by stating that it is necessary that the Americans break away from Britain. Much of their philosophy is influenced by the Enlightenment years of the 17th and 18th centuries, where we adopted many ideas from English philosopher, John Locke. In these paragraphs, the Americans started with an introduction and stated their philosophy. The first section consists of the first and second paragraphs. This committee of writers consisted of Thomas Jefferson, Benjamin Franklin, John Adams, Robert Livingston, Roger Sherman. The committee of writers not only wanted to declare the Americans were splitting from Britain but also set down some ideas and beliefs for our soon to come government. The document has three main sections with its own purpose and meaning: The first section stating America’s philosophy, the second section with a list of the American’s grievances, and the third section stating the colonies were now independent. However, there is a lot more in the document than the Americans just simply declaring they were going to break away from Britain. It led to the Revolutionary war and the Americans gaining their independence. The Declaration of Independence is one of the most important documents in American history.
